#MissMarpleMonthly: A Pocket Full of Rye by Agatha Christie

A Pocket Full of Rye is a murder mystery novel written by Agatha Christie and first published in the United Kingdom by William Collins, Sons in 1953. The novel features her famous detective, Miss Marple, as she investigates a series of murders that take place in the household of the wealthy businessman, Rex Fortescue. The Impact of Freeman Wills Crofts on the Mystery Genre

Freeman Wills Crofts (1879-1957) was an Irish mystery novelist who was one of the leading writers of the Golden Age of detective fiction. He is best known for his intricate and complex plots, his emphasis on scientific accuracy and forensic detection, and his focus on the mechanics of detection. Book Review: The Quiche of Death by M. C. Beaton (2003)

The Agatha Raisin series, written by M. C. Beaton (also known as Marion Chesney), is a popular collection of cozy mystery novels featuring the eponymous amateur detective Agatha Raisin. The series is set in the picturesque Cotswolds village of Carsely, England, and follows Agatha as she solves various crimes and navigates the complexities of village life. TV Series Review: The Brokenwood Mysteries (2014 – Present)

“The Brokenwood Mysteries” is a New Zealand television series that premiered in 2014. The show follows Detective Senior Sergeant Mike Shepherd (Neill Rea) as he investigates various crimes in the small, fictional town of Brokenwood. Miss Marple Monthly: They Do it With Mirrors by Agatha Christie (Miss Marple Mysteries, 6)

They Do It With Mirrors is a detective novel written by Agatha Christie, one of the most popular and successful writers of all time. It was first published in 1952 and features one of Christie’s most beloved characters, Miss Marple, as she works to solve a puzzling crime.
